Description
You are welcomed into more than just a comfortable home, it’s a vibrant community. Residents can enjoy a thoughtfully planned weekly timetable of activities, including coffee mornings twice a week, fish and chip nights, wine and cheese evenings, and many more social and recreational events. With such a lively calendar, there’s always something to look forward to, fostering friendships, fun, and a truly engaging lifestyle!
This beautifully appointed first-floor retirement apartment offers a superb blend of comfort, security, and modern living within a well-maintained and thoughtfully designed development. Positioned in a highly desirable setting, the property provides spacious, low-maintenance accommodation ideal for those seeking both independence and a sense of community.
Accessed via lift or stairs, the apartment opens into a welcoming private hallway with useful storage. The main living space is bright and generously proportioned, offering a flexible lounge and dining area that is perfect for both everyday living and entertaining. Doors lead directly onto a private balcony, providing a pleasant outdoor space to relax and enjoy the surroundings.
The kitchen is stylish and practical, fitted with contemporary units, integrated appliances, and ample worktop space, making it both functional and easy to use.
There are two well-proportioned double bedrooms, with the principal bedroom benefiting from a walk-in wardrobe and a modern en-suite bathroom. A separate, well-finished shower room serves the second bedroom, offering convenience for guests.
The development itself is designed with ease of living in mind, featuring a secure entry system, a 24-hour emergency call service, and welcoming communal spaces including a residents’ lounge-ideal for socialising or relaxing. Externally, the property enjoys access to attractive communal gardens and benefits from an allocated parking space.
Location
Situated close to Solihull town centre, the apartment is ideally placed for a wide range of amenities including shops, cafés, and restaurants, as well as the popular Touchwood Shopping Centre. Excellent transport connections and access to Birmingham Airport further enhance the convenience of this well-connected location.

Exclusivity Fee:
You can secure the purchase by paying an exclusivity fee of £2,000. This grants the buyer exclusive rights to proceed with the purchase for the duration of the conveyancing process, during which time the seller agrees to remove the property from the market and not negotiate with other parties.
The exclusivity fee is returned to the buyer upon successful completion of the purchase.
A processing fee of £200 is required in order to draw up an exclusive legally binding contract between the buyer and seller. This agreement sets out the terms of exclusivity and seller commitment but does not constitute an exchange of contracts.
This arrangement provides buyers with reassurance that the property is secured exclusively for them, reducing the risk of gazumping and unnecessary aborted costs.
